About This Equipment

The GENIE V1854 AERIAL LIFTS are a game-changer in the construction industry, boasting a maximum platform height of 18 feet and a lifting capacity of 500 pounds, making them ideal for a wide range of tasks. Equipped with a reliable electric motor, these lifts offer smooth and precise maneuverability, while their compact design allows for easy transportation and operation in tight spaces. With features such as proportional lift and drive controls, zero inside turning radius, and non-marking tires, the GENIE V1854 AERIAL LIFTS ensure efficiency and safety on the job site.
